Internationally renowned artists in Kapopoulos Fine Arts in Nicosia, Grand Opening 31 October 2025

Kapopoulos Fine Arts is opening a new group exhibition at its Nicosia gallery on October 31, 2025, featuring works by internationally renowned artists including Damien Hirst, Salvador Dalí, Mr. Brainwash, and Richard Orlinski, alongside prominent Greek creators such as Alekos Fassianos and Yannis Gaitis. The three-day opening event runs through November 2, with the exhibition continuing until November 17, showcasing paintings and sculptures sourced directly from artists' studios.

Kapopoulos Fine Arts Presents Contemporary Art Auction in Nicosia

Kapopoulos Fine Arts will hold a Contemporary Art Auction on February 18, 2026, at its Nicosia Gallery. The sale features 82 works, with highlights including pieces by street artist Mr. Brainwash (Thierry Guetta), Greek painter Yiannis Mytaras, and sculptor Richard Orlinski, alongside works by Kostis Georgiou, Spyros Vassiliou, and others. Starting prices range from €300, with bidding available in person, by phone, or via absentee bids.

Contemporary art auction of Greek and international artworks

Kapopoulos Auction House will hold a live auction of over 80 works by Greek and international artists at Kapopoulos Fine Arts gallery in Nicosia, Cyprus, on Wednesday, May 28 at 19:00. The auction features works by artists such as Alecos Fassianos, Angelos Panayiotou, Opy Zouni, Mr. Brainwash, Costas Andreou, and Spyros Vassiliou, with starting prices set at unusually low levels. Preview days run from May 26 to May 28, and written offers are also accepted.

Things to do on Wednesday, February 18

A wide array of cultural events are scheduled across Cyprus for Wednesday, February 18. These include the opening of a curated showcase of publications from the late archaeologist Vassos Karageorghis in Nicosia, a contemporary art auction featuring 82 works, a presentation by underwater photographer Sakis Lazaridis, a sold-out theatre performance in Limassol, and numerous ongoing exhibitions in Nicosia, Limassol, and Larnaca featuring both historic and contemporary Cypriot artists.
